Does it matter at all where the offset killer is placed? If you correct DC on, say, only the master track, does that differ from doing so at the source?

Would an offset track place any special kind of interference in a mix if it is not immediately corrected?...is what I mean

Post

you should kill it at the source. It might not matter in practical terms (it really depends on your inserts/sends, type of DC offset, source signals, and overall headroom), but since DC will lower your headroom, clipping will be more likely to occur.
